Struempel Ear Punch Forceps PS-5223 are reusable ENT biopsy forceps manufactured from German stainless steel for controlled aural tissue punching, sampling, and removal in otologic procedures. The listed size is PS-5223 8.5cm / 3-1/4 inch, giving the surgeon a compact long-shaft profile for work through the external auditory canal under otoscopic or microscopic visualization. This instrument is used in external ear canal biopsy, aural polyp removal, granulation tissue sampling, limited canal lesion excision, tympanoplasty adjunctive tissue handling, and otologic operating room procedures requiring a defined bite in a narrow corridor. The long shaft, distal biopsy jaw, box joint, pivoted handle, and ring-handle control allow accurate placement at the selected tissue margin while the operator keeps the hand clear of the visual field. ENT surgeons, otologists, hospital operating rooms, ambulatory surgery centers, and ear specialty clinics select this Class I reusable forceps pattern for compact access, controlled bite mechanics, and regulated instrument procurement.

Distal Jaw and Ring Handle Mechanics

The Struempel pattern uses a narrow long shaft to reach the external auditory canal while keeping the handle outside the speculum and microscope working area. The distal biopsy jaw is designed to capture a defined tissue segment before closure, allowing a controlled punch action rather than surface grasping alone. This is useful when the surgeon needs to sample canal granulation, aural polyp tissue, or a small lesion margin with minimal instrument sweep. The box joint keeps both arms aligned during closure, supporting predictable jaw contact at the working end. The pivot converts ring-handle compression into measured distal movement, giving the surgeon tactile control during bite placement. Finger rings stabilize the hand during repeated opening and closing in confined otologic access. The compact 8.5cm length supports close control at the ear canal while maintaining enough reach for precise tissue engagement under direct visualization.

Otologic Indications and Procedure Flow

During external ear canal biopsy, the forceps are introduced after visualization, canal cleaning, and localization of the tissue target. The distal jaw is positioned against the selected margin, closed to obtain a defined bite, and withdrawn with the specimen or tissue segment. In aural polyp removal, the instrument helps isolate the stalk or focal tissue area before removal, especially when standard dressing forceps provide less precise purchase. In granulation tissue sampling, the punch action supports controlled removal from the canal wall or postoperative otologic site. During tympanoplasty preparation or revision ear surgery, the forceps may assist with selective removal of small obstructing tissue that limits access or visualization. The 8.5cm pattern is suited for narrow access because the shaft remains controlled while the hand stays outside the microscope field. It is used as a focused biopsy and tissue removal instrument, not as a general clamping forceps.

How are Struempel Ear Punch Forceps different from Hartmann ear forceps?
Hartmann ear forceps are commonly used for grasping dressing material, packing, or small foreign material in the ear canal. Struempel Ear Punch Forceps are designed for a punch-style bite during aural tissue sampling. The distal biopsy jaw captures a defined tissue segment, while Hartmann jaws mainly grasp and hold. This makes the Struempel pattern more suitable for canal biopsy, granulation tissue removal, and aural polyp work. Hartmann forceps are selected for handling, while this instrument is selected for controlled tissue removal. The mechanical difference is grasping versus biopsy punch action.

How does the box joint and pivot control intraoperative use?
The box joint keeps the two forceps arms aligned as the handle closes. The pivot converts ring-handle compression into controlled movement at the distal biopsy jaw. This lets the surgeon place the jaw on a selected canal lesion, aural polyp, or granulation tissue before taking a measured bite. Struempel Ear Punch Forceps rely on this mechanism to work in narrow otologic access without broad shaft movement. The ring handles support stable finger placement during repeated opening and closure. This control is important when working under magnification inside the external auditory canal.
